Expand Up @@ -39,6 +39,16 @@ def wrap_express_app(file: Path) -> App:
)

app_ui = run_express(file)
try:
# We tagify here, instead of waiting for the App object to do it when it wraps
# the UI in a HTMLDocument and calls render() on it. This is because
# AttributeErrors can be thrown during the tagification process, and we need to
# catch them here and convert them to a different type of error, because uvicorn
# specifically catches AttributeErrors and prints an error message that is
# misleading for Shiny Express. https://github.com/posit-dev/py-shiny/issues/937
app_ui = run_express(file).tagify()
except AttributeError as e:
raise RuntimeError(e) from e
